Over 10 years we help companies reach their financial and branding goals. Engitech is a values-driven technology agency dedicated.

Gallery

Contacts

411 University St, Seattle, USA

engitech@oceanthemes.net

+1 -800-456-478-23

Software Quality Engineering

Helping organisations deliver reliable, safe and high-performing digital systems
through rigorous engineering, independent validation and deep technical expertise.
How we can help

Release with confidence

Strategic Advisory. Solid Assurance.

KJR has built an extensive track record in delivering software quality assurance, having worked on some of Australia’s largest and most complex technology-based projects. 

From manual testing and test automation to cloud migration and company-wide digital transformation, our collective expertise ensures your business objectives are achieved to the highest possible standards.

Work colleague looking at a laptop screen
Software Quality Engineering Services

Intelligent Solutions. Trusted Outcomes.

Founded on software testing in 1997, KJR continues to deliver expertise in software quality assurance and testing 30 years on.

Test Assurance & Governance

Improving delivery confidence

As systems grow more complex, achieving quality requires clear assurance, structured oversight and alignment to business risk.

KJR’s Test Assurance & Governance services provide independent quality assurance and governance, ensuring testing strategies align with delivery objectives and drive better business outcomes.

Test Automation

Faster delivery, lower risk, better quality

As organisations modernise, manual testing alone is no longer sufficient to ensure reliable delivery.

KJR’s Test Automation services help your teams deliver faster with confidence, designing and implementing robust, scalable automation frameworks that align to your business needs.

Performance Testing

Reliable performance at scale

When organisations rely on digital platforms to deliver services, even small performance issues can become costly.

KJR’s Performance Testing services give you the assurance that your systems will perform when it matters most.

Functional Testing

Systems that work. Every time.

Reliable delivery depends on systems working as expected across workflows, integrations and user journeys.

KJR’s Functional Testing services ensure systems work as intended across real-world scenarios, validating business processes, user journeys and integrations before release.

Test Data Management

Enabling reliable testing through controlled, realistic and secure data

Modern testing depends on data that is available, consistent and aligned across environments. Without it, testing becomes unreliable, automation cannot scale and delivery slows down.

KJR’s Test Data Management services ensure the right data is available at the right time, enabling effective testing, scalable delivery and reliable system outcomes.

DevOps

Speed up delivery. Strengthen reliability.

DevOps enables organisations to move quickly from idea to production by automating delivery, improving collaboration and increasing resilience.

KJR provides the assurance, tooling and practices needed to deliver at speed, while maintaining quality, security and operational stability.

SQE in Action

KJR Case Studies

Austroads Data Platform

KJR’s automated assurance framework enabled Austroads to validate complex, high-volume data pipelines with speed and accuracy. This empowered better decision-making, regulatory readiness, and scalable insights for future national road charging initiatives.

Read More »

Rowing Australia

Rowing Australia (RA) is the national governing body for the sport of rowing. Rowing in Australia is operationalised via a federated model, which links member associations across seven (7) States and Territories in Australia.

Read More »

Release With Confidence

Quality is what enables organisations to release faster, operate reliably and earn trust in every digital interaction.

 

Talk to KJR about improving software quality at speed using this form

 

or contact your local KJR General Manager.

Frequently Asked Questions (FAQ)

How does SQE reduce business risk?

SQE reduces business risk by making quality part of the delivery process from the start, helping teams identify defects, process gaps, and release risks earlier. It gives teams confidence in the technology by using shared quality signals, early checks, and measurable outcomes to support release decisions.

How does SQE accelerate delivery?

SQE accelerates delivery by reducing rework, improving feedback loops, and helping teams catch issues earlier in the lifecycle. When quality is built in from the beginning, teams can move faster with less disruption and more confidence at release time.

What does a mature SQE practice look like?

A mature SQE practice is proactive, embedded, and aligned to business outcomes. It combines strong collaboration across teams, risk- based thinking, automation where it adds value, and continuous feedback loops that help teams improve quality across the delivery lifecycle.

How do you know SQE is working?

You know SQE is working when quality decisions are supported by measurable evidence, and when quality, confidence, and delivery outcomes improve over time. Rather than focusing on test execution volume alone, effective SQE measures what matters most: coverage of business-critical journeys, visibility of key risks, strength of feedback loops, and confidence to release. These insights help teams make better decisions and drive continuous improvement.

How do you shift from reactive testing to proactive quality engineering?

This shift means involving quality earlier, sharing ownership across the team, and using data to spot trends, weak points, and recurring failure patterns before they reach production. The goal is to move from late defect detection to building quality in from the beginning, with shorter feedback loops and fewer surprises at release time.

Strengthen your AI strategy from every angle